[KDM-20 Automotive Muscovite Mica Powder] Overview

[KDM-20 Automotive Muscovite Mica Powder] is a high-purity, automotive-grade muscovite designed for demanding applications across the Non metallic mineral products industry and the Manufacturing of graphite and other non-metallic mineral products. Engineered with a controlled flake morphology and a nominal 20-mesh grading, it offers excellent barrier, dielectric, and thermal stability properties that enhance composite performance and processing consistency. Its lamellar structure contributes to dimensional stability, improved reinforcement, and reduced shrinkage in polymers, coatings, and friction materials.

From a technical perspective, muscovite’s inherent plate-like particles provide a high aspect ratio and low oil absorption, supporting good dispersibility and viscosity control in resin systems. The KDM-20 grade is carefully classified to minimize dust, ensure uniform particle distribution, and reduce impurities that could affect downstream processing or color tone. Typical use environments include elevated temperatures and high-vibration assemblies where stability, electrical insulation, and resistance to moisture are essential.

Benefits & Use Cases of [KDM-20 Automotive Muscovite Mica Powder] in Manufacturing of graphite and other non-metallic mineral products

In the Manufacturing of graphite and other non-metallic mineral products, [KDM-20 Automotive Muscovite Mica Powder] delivers multi-functional performance. In friction materials and brake systems—often formulated with graphite—KDM-20 enhances thermal stability, maintains friction coefficients, and helps resist fade under repeated braking cycles. In polymer and elastomer components, it improves stiffness-to-weight ratios, dimensional stability, and warpage control, while its barrier effect contributes to corrosion protection in underbody coatings and e-coats.

The product’s electrical insulation properties make it a reliable choice for EV battery-adjacent plastics, cable and wire compounds, and gasketing materials where arc resistance and dielectric strength are vital. Its plate-like particles form tortuous paths that improve moisture and gas barrier performance in coatings and sealants, supporting longer component life in harsh environments. For foundry and refractory-related processes, KDM-20 aids release characteristics and surface finish consistency.
